Abstract

Official abstract text for this publication.

Provided is a glass fiber-reinforced resin molded article having high dimension stability and low dielectric characteristics. In the glass fiber-reinforced resin molded article, the fiber diameter D of glass fiber included in the glass fiber-reinforced resin molded article is in the range of 5.0 to 15.0 μm, the dielectric constant Dk at a measurement frequency of 1 GHz of the glass fiber is in the range of 4.0 to 7.0, the linear expansion coefficient C of the glass fiber is in the range of 2.0 to 6.0 ppm/K, the number average fiber length L of the glass fiber is in the range of 150 to 400 μm, and the D, Dk, C, and L satisfy the following formula (1): 57.9≤ Dk×C 1/4 ×L 1/2 /D 1/4 ≤70.6  (1)

First claim

Opening claim text (preview).

The invention claimed is: 1. A glass fiber-reinforced resin molded article, wherein a fiber diameter D of glass fiber included in the glass fiber-reinforced resin molded article is in a range of 5.0 to 15.0 μm, a dielectric constant Dk at a measurement frequency of 1 GHz of the glass fiber included in the glass fiber-reinforced resin molded article is in a range of 5.1 to 7.0, a linear expansion coefficient C of the glass fiber included in the glass fiber-reinforced resin molded article is in a range of 2.0 to 6.0 ppm/K, a number average fiber length L of the glass fiber included in the glass fiber-reinforced resin molded article is in a range of 150 to 400 μm, and the D, Dk, C, and L satisfy a following formula (1): 58.2≤ Dk×C 1/4 ×L 1/2 /D 1/4 ≤61.7  (1) 2. The glass fiber-reinforced resin molded article according to claim 1 , wherein the glass fiber included in the glass fiber-reinforced resin molded article comprises a composition including SiO 2 in a range of 60.00 to 70.00% by mass, Al 2 O 3 in a range of 20.00 to 30.00% by mass, MgO in a range of 5.00 to 15.0% by mass, Fe 2 O 3 in a range of 0.15 to 1.50% by mass, and Li 2 O, Na 2 O, and K 2 O in a range of 0.02 to 0.20% by mass in total, with respect to a total amount of the glass fiber. 3. The glass fiber-reinforced resin molded article according to claim 1 , wherein a resin contained in the glass fiber-reinforced resin molded article is polybutylene terephthalate. 4. The glass fiber-reinforced resin molded article according to claim 2 , wherein a resin contained in the glass fiber-reinforced resin molded article is polybutylene terephthalate.
